About City of Moreton Bay

Strathpine, QLD, Australia

Moreton Bay Region is one of the fastest developing places in Australia. Situated between Brisbane and the Sunshine Coast, our Region is one of diverse communities and landscapes.

It covers coastal settlements including Redcliffe, Beachmere and Bribie Island, rural townships and mountain villages like Mt Mee, Woodford, Dayboro and Mt Glorious, established areas such as the Hills District and rapidly expanding urban centres like North Lakes, Morayfield and Narangba.
